What is the Yunnan Impression Show?

The Yunnan Impression Show is a lively 100-minute performance that takes you into the heart of Yunnan’s ethnic minorities. It’s a curated cultural journey offering a glimpse into their rituals, daily labors, celebrations, and love stories through traditional song and dance. Think of it as a moving storytelling session where music, costumes, and choreography bring ancestors’ memories to life.
The show is set in a theater with a stage designed to evoke natural landscapes like the Cangshan Mountains or Erhai Lake, helping you feel transported directly into Yunnan’s scenic backdrop. As the drums echo and singers belt out melodies, it becomes clear that this performance isn’t just entertainment—it’s a tribute to the cultural soul of the region.

Additional Practical Details

- Reservation & Cancellation: You can cancel up to 24 hours in advance for a full refund, providing flexibility if your plans change. Booking is “reserve now, pay later,” which is handy for flexible planning.
- Tickets & Entry: Make sure to provide your full name and passport number during booking, as your reservation hinges on this info. The QR code you receive isn’t your ticket; you’ll need to communicate via WhatsApp or email for confirmation.
- Language & Group Size: The show is conducted in Chinese, but the small group setting enhances intimacy, and the visual storytelling helps bridge language gaps.
- Duration & Timing: The show runs daily at 8:00 PM and lasts approximately 100 minutes, fitting well into an evening itinerary.
What to Bring
Bring your passport or ID card, as proof of identity. Also, it’s wise to avoid bringing weapons, sharp objects, alcohol, or drugs, aligning with safety regulations.
